Factors Influencing Cost

Slate roof construction in Riverton, CT, involves installing durable, natural stone tiles that provide a distinctive appearance and long-lasting protection. Understanding the typical scope and considerations of slate roofing projects can help in planning and comparing options for this traditional roofing material.

  • Materials: Natural slate tiles, known for their durability and aesthetic appeal, are the primary material used in slate roof construction.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ential sections to extensive roof areas, often covering entire roofs with multiple layers of slate tiles.
  • Labor Complexity: Installing slate roofing requires specialized skills, making labor more intricate and potentially longer in duration compared to other roofing types.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Riverton may require permits for slate roof installations, especially for large or historic properties.
  • Extras: Additional components such as flashing, underlayment, and ridge caps are typically included to ensure waterproofing and aesthetic finishing.
